Can you remind us what the total damage will be for a clinic?

 

It's $450 plus fee for using the facility/green fee, etc., which is usually around &150.

 

OK, maybe I am biased...so what. The clinic price for three days is one the of the best deals you will ever find in golf.

 

$600 is $600 and to some it is an affordability issue, I totally get that. But if anyone is wondering if it is worth it? Wondering if you can benefit? Wondering if it is time well spent? Stop the nonsense thinking and get signed up.

 

Many of us have wasted far more than $600 on things long gone; experiences long forgotten. But in this case, you will be hitting shots that you learned at this clinic for as long as you play golf.
